Gunsight at Sunset

Gunsight Mountain as taken at sunset on a cold February evening near Eureka Lodge on the Glen Highway, Alaska. The reason for the name of the mountain is quite obvious!

Sony a6300, SE1670Z @ 53 mm, ISO-100, f/9.0, 1/400, hand held.
